当前位置: 首页 > news >正文

Nanbeige 4.1-3B应用:打造个人专属二次元风格AI助手

Nanbeige 4.1-3B应用:打造个人专属二次元风格AI助手

1. 引言:当AI助手遇见二次元美学

在本地部署大语言模型的过程中,一个常见的痛点就是交互界面过于技术化,缺乏个性化和美感。今天我要介绍的Nanbeige 4.1-3B Streamlit WebUI,完美解决了这个问题——它将专业的大模型能力与二次元风格的界面设计巧妙结合,让你拥有一个既强大又养眼的AI助手。

这个界面最吸引人的地方在于其独特的视觉风格:浅灰蓝的波点背景、左右分明的聊天气泡、微妙的呼吸阴影效果,整体呈现出类似《蔚蓝档案》MomoTalk的二次元游戏对话风格。但它的价值远不止好看这么简单——智能的思考过程折叠、丝滑的流式输出、极简的单文件架构,都让这个WebUI成为本地部署Nanbeige模型的首选方案。

2. 核心功能解析

2.1 沉浸式对话体验

传统的AI对话界面往往采用单调的列表式布局,而这个WebUI则完全模拟了手机短信的交互形式:

  • 用户消息:右侧天蓝色气泡,模拟真实聊天应用
  • AI回复:左侧白色气泡,带有呼吸阴影效果
  • 背景设计:浅灰蓝波点矩阵,既美观又不干扰阅读
  • 输入区域:悬浮药丸状设计,保持界面整洁

这种设计让每一次对话都像在和自己喜欢的二次元角色聊天,大大提升了使用体验的沉浸感。

2.2 智能对话管理

针对大语言模型的特点,这个WebUI实现了多项实用功能:

  • 思考过程折叠:自动识别<think>...</think>标签,将模型推理过程收纳到折叠面板中
  • 流式输出优化:基于TextIteratorStreamer实现打字机效果,防抖处理避免气泡闪烁
  • 对话历史管理:右上角悬浮"清空记录"按钮,一键重置对话上下文
  • 响应式布局:适配不同屏幕尺寸,在手机和平板上也能良好显示

3. 快速部署指南

3.1 环境准备

部署这个WebUI只需要基础的Python环境,推荐使用Python 3.10+版本。安装依赖也非常简单:

pip install streamlit torch transformers accelerate

3.2 模型准备

首先需要下载Nanbeige 4.1-3B模型权重,可以通过Hugging Face Hub获取:

git lfs install git clone https://huggingface.co/Nanbeige/Nanbeige4-3B

3.3 配置与启动

  1. 下载WebUI代码后,修改app.py中的模型路径:
MODEL_PATH = "/your/local/path/to/Nanbeige4-3B"
  1. 启动服务:
streamlit run app.py
  1. 浏览器会自动打开http://localhost:8501,即可开始使用

4. 技术实现亮点

4.1 CSS魔法实现精美界面

这个项目最令人惊叹的是它仅用CSS就实现了如此精美的界面效果:

  • :has()伪类选择器:动态判断气泡对齐方向
  • Flex布局:实现完美的左右对话布局
  • CSS动画:创造呼吸阴影效果
  • 响应式设计:适配不同设备尺寸

所有样式都集中定义在app.py文件顶部,修改起来非常方便。

4.2 高效的流式输出

通过多线程技术和TextIteratorStreamer的结合,实现了:

  • 真正的逐字输出效果
  • 输出过程中界面不卡顿
  • 自动滚动保持最新消息可见
  • 异常处理确保稳定性

5. 个性化定制建议

5.1 视觉风格调整

你可以轻松修改CSS来打造专属风格:

  • 更改背景颜色或图案
  • 调整气泡颜色和形状
  • 添加自定义动画效果
  • 修改字体和排版样式

5.2 功能扩展思路

如果想进一步开发,可以考虑:

  • 添加对话导出功能
  • 集成模型参数调整界面
  • 支持多模型切换
  • 实现对话历史保存与加载

6. 总结与展望

6.1 项目价值总结

Nanbeige 4.1-3B Streamlit WebUI展示了如何用简洁的技术方案打造精美的AI应用界面。它的核心价值在于:

  1. 美观的界面设计:二次元风格提升使用体验
  2. 高效的实现方式:单文件架构易于部署和维护
  3. 实用的功能特性:思考折叠、流式输出等增强可用性
  4. 开放的定制空间:CSS和Python代码都易于修改

6.2 应用前景展望

这个项目为本地大模型部署提供了一个优秀的参考方案,特别适合:

  • 个人用户打造专属AI助手
  • 开发者快速构建演示界面
  • 二次元爱好者定制个性化交互
  • 教育场景创建友好学习环境

随着模型性能的不断提升,这类注重用户体验的部署方案将变得越来越重要。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

http://www.jsqmd.com/news/595655/

相关文章:

  • Pixel Language Portal效果展示:技术文档→多语种Markdown的结构化翻译与格式保持案例
  • seo综合查询工具和网站分析工具有什么区别_seo综合查询工具如何分析网站关键词排名
  • Qwen3.5-2B生成Typora风格技术文档:Markdown与图表自动编排
  • 005、Git远程协作:连接GitHub/Gitee,掌握Push、Pull与团队协作规范
  • Guohua Diffusion 辅助教育教学:快速生成历史场景与科学图解
  • BUG列表:QQ 发送邮件发生异常
  • K8s集群认证文件丢失的5个常见原因及预防措施(含etcd数据保护建议)
  • OpenClaw权限管控:安全使用SecGPT-14B的5条黄金法则
  • [嵌入式] 详解 30 脚 OLED 裸屏与 4 脚 I2C 模块的区别:从硬件配置到代码驱动
  • FLUX.2-klein-base-9b-nvfp4快速入门:小白也能玩转AI图片编辑
  • 华硕笔记本智能Lid控制解决方案:3步终结外接显示器合盖休眠难题
  • Linux 软件安装没你想的那么简单:为什么有的软件能直接跑,有的非装不可?
  • 百川2-13B模型助力网络安全:威胁情报分析与报告自动生成
  • 颠覆传统:5大鲜为人知的显卡性能解锁技巧
  • [GROMACS]模拟数据分析前轨迹文件生成-轨迹预处理
  • 别再只盯着Finalshell和Xshell了!这5款免费/开源的SSH客户端同样能打(含Mac/Linux选项)
  • Windows平台OpenClaw部署教程:Qwen3-14b_int4_awq模型接入
  • Downkyi完全指南:高效管理B站视频资源的4个关键步骤
  • 办公神器PasteMD:粘贴即美化,技术日志、网页内容一键整理
  • Pixel Script Temple 开发环境配置:Visual Studio一站式安装与调试
  • OpenClaw电商运营助手:Qwen2.5-VL-7B批量生成商品图文详情
  • 西门子200smart与施耐德ATV变频器modbus通讯 西门子s7-200smart与施耐...
  • 从RTL到GDS:一个时钟MUX模块的完整时序约束实战(含PrimeTime脚本)
  • OpenClaw开源贡献:为Qwen3-4B-Thinking-2507-GPT-5-Codex-Distill-GGUF开发社区技能
  • OpenClaw云端体验方案:星图平台Qwen2.5-VL-7B镜像快速测试
  • OpenClaw多模态实践:Qwen3.5-9B-VL解析PDF图表与报告生成
  • DeOldify多用户并发测试:100+请求下服务稳定性与响应延迟实测
  • 小白也能懂:DeepSeek-R1-Distill-Qwen-7B部署与使用全攻略
  • 华硕笔记本外接显示器的无缝体验:GHelper智能合盖模式深度解析
  • 2026年目前靠谱的真空波纹管厂家口碑推荐,波纹金属软管/真空波纹管/焊接波纹管/波纹补偿器,真空波纹管厂家哪个好 - 品牌推荐师